10:42 am Engadget: iTunes 7 is available today as a free download from apple.com
10:41 am iLounge: iPod boxes now show Pirates of the Carribbean
10:41 am iLounge: U.S. now, International in 2007.
10:41 am iLounge: Dolby surround audio in videos
10:40 am iLounge: Near DVD quality. Same encoding as TV shows at 640x480. If you have a 5mb/s broadband connection, it will take approximately 30 minutes to download a movie
10:38 am iLounge: most titles will be 9.99
10:38 am iLounge: New releases 12.99 preorders and first week, after that up to 14.99
10:38 am iLounge: 75 films online today, more every week and month
10:37 am iLounge: Today, films from Walt Disney, Pixar, Touchstone, Miramax. (all Disney owned)
10:37 am iLounge: Tv shows - started with 1 network, 5 shows.
10:36 am iLounge: movies
10:36 am iLounge: "one more thing..."
10:34 am iLounge: Video on screen now markedly higher resolution
10:33 am correction: it appears as though the nano's packaging is 52% smaller, not the nano itself.
10:31 am iLounge: Demo of iTunes 7
10:31 am 10:27AM Engadget: You can update your iPod from right inside iTunes now, you don't need to go to Preferences. You can say, "I want to sync the 10 most recent unwatched episides of all my TV shows."
10:30 am Engadget: Now, all of this video is encoded with the best encoding in the world, H.264. We've been distributing it at 320x240. Today, we're going to take that up a notch to 640x480. That's 4x the resolution. iTunes 7 also has seamless playback for video.
10:30 am iLounge: you can now sync between multiple computers using an iPod, as long as both are authorized on the same account
10:28 am Engadget: Today we're introducing the biggest single enhancement: iTunes 7
You say "it looks the same," but it isn't
[the left nav is more cleanly organized without being radically different]
We've added a View switch, a 3-position switch. we've added a 2nd view called album view, so you can scroll through your music library and look at it by album. what if you ripped your CDs and don't have the covers? Today we're announcing free missing album cover art for all the music in your library if you have an itune acct. itunes will automatically download it for free
but there's something even better. that's the third view. it's called Cover Flow view. [LOOKS LIKE FLIPPLING THROUGH YOUR CD RACK]
10:28 am iLounge: TV shows are now encoded at 640x480 (h264), up from 320x240
10:27 am iLounge: iPod updater appears to be now integrated into iTunes
10:26 am iLounge: 3 different views of iTunes, list view, album view (with art and tracks), then "cover flow view" lets you rapidly find what you want by album cover
10:25 am iLounge: iTunes will give you cover art for free if you are missing cover art (thanks Steve)
10:24 am iLounge: Store now has own section, devices have their own sections, playlists too
10:24 am iLounge: Source list now includes library with sep libraries for all forms of media
10:23 am iLounge: iTunes 7 today
10:22 am Engadget: (for nano) $149 2GB ipod is aluminum only, $199 4GB has colors, $249 8GB is black only

10:21 am iLounge: metal body, 1 model (1GB), $79, ships in october.
10:18 am iLounge: iPod Shuffle is now 2nd generationl size of iPod Radio Remote
10:17 am iLounge: All models are 52% smaller in volume than previous nano. new charger, new armband, new lanyard
10:16 am iLounge: 8GB is $249 in all colors
10:16 am iLounge: 4GB is $199 in all colors but black
10:16 am iLounge: 2GB is $149 in silver only
10:16 am iLounge: 3 models, but with double storage capacity at each model (and varying colors available)
10:15 am iLounge: New software just like standard iPod
10:14 am iLounge: 24 hour batter life
10:14 am iLounge: Green silver black blue pink
10:12 am iLounge: Nano is now, as rumored, Aluminum and in colors
10:12 am iLounge: 249 and 349 with 60GB and 80GB capacity
10:10 am iLounge: games will work on 5G ipods
10:09 am iLounge: games for sale off iTunes for $4.99
10:08 am iLounge: new iPod software features: instant searching, new games (Bejeweled, Cubis 2, Mahjong, Mini golf, pac man, tetris, texas holdem, vortex, and zuma)
10:07 am iLounge: iPod is getting enhanced today. 60% brighter with brighness control, 3.5 hours video playback (up from 2 hrs... big version goes to 6.5 hours), new headphones, gapless playback
10:06 am iLounge: iPods. 3 iPods: iPod, Nano, and Shuffle
10:05 am iLounge: talks about iPod sports kit. Foot Locker is blown away by sales. 450,000 sales in 90 days
10:04 am the event appears to have begun
10:03 am iLounge: theater is filled to capacity (755 person theater). Podium on the right, a computer setup on the left of the stage (looks like an iMac)
9:52 am iLounge: Folks are crowding to get up-front seats. (wonder why?)
9:51 am iLounge: Griffin Technology, Belkin, Incase and Nike are in attendance.
